On Thu, 2006-03-16 at 16:14 -0500, Eric Beversluis wrote:
> I can't fine a graphical device in FC4 that lets me mount and set to
> mount automatically on boot my NTFS and FAT32 Windows partitions (dual
> boot system; hda1 and hda5). System Tools, Disk Management only shows
> the disks already mounted. How does a nongeek do this? There was always
> a way to do it with Mandrake 10.1.
> 
> PS--on my external HDD, FC4 mounts the FAT32 but claims not to be able
> to recognize the NTFS partition.
> 
You will need to install the ntfs module for your kernel to be able to
access the ntfs filesystem.

see http://www.linux-ntfs.org/
